Definitions
adj.形容词 adjective
- 1
pert·er, pert·est.
- : boldly forward in speech or behavior; impertinent; saucy.
- : jaunty and stylish; chic; natty.
- : lively; sprightly; in good health.
- : Obsolete. clever.
